首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从github运行每个flutter应用程序的问题(因为xml >=4.4.0 <4.4.1依赖于posittparser^3.1.0和xml )

从github运行每个flutter应用程序的问题是由于xml依赖的版本冲突导致的。具体来说,xml的版本要求是大于等于4.4.0且小于4.4.1,并且依赖于posittparser的版本为^3.1.0。

解决这个问题的方法有以下几种:

  1. 更新xml和posittparser的版本:可以尝试将xml和posittparser的版本更新到满足要求的范围内。可以通过修改项目的pubspec.yaml文件中的依赖版本来实现。例如,将xml的版本更新为^4.4.0,posittparser的版本更新为^3.1.0。
  2. 解决依赖冲突:如果更新版本无法解决问题,可以尝试手动解决依赖冲突。可以通过查看项目的依赖关系图,找到冲突的依赖项,并尝试将其替换为与其他依赖项兼容的版本。
  3. 使用依赖管理工具:如果手动解决依赖冲突比较困难,可以考虑使用依赖管理工具来自动解决依赖冲突。例如,可以使用Flutter的依赖管理工具pub来管理项目的依赖关系,并自动解决冲突。
  4. 寻求开发者社区的帮助:如果以上方法都无法解决问题,可以到Flutter的开发者社区寻求帮助。在社区中,可以向其他开发者提问并分享自己遇到的问题,他们可能会给出更具体的解决方案或建议。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云Flutter开发平台:提供了丰富的开发工具和资源,帮助开发者快速构建和部署Flutter应用。了解更多信息,请访问腾讯云Flutter开发平台
  • 腾讯云云服务器(CVM):提供高性能、可扩展的云服务器实例,适用于各种应用场景。了解更多信息,请访问腾讯云云服务器(CVM)
  • 腾讯云对象存储(COS):提供安全可靠的云端存储服务,适用于存储和管理各种类型的数据。了解更多信息,请访问腾讯云对象存储(COS)

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Mac版最详细Flutter开发环境搭建

,程序员必备工具,很多Mac都没有安装brew,但它在环境搭建中有着超级大作用,所以没有的童鞋先去安装 下载Flutter SDK 两种方式:官网下载github下载 flutter官网下载地址点击进入...在国内因为中所周知原因,要想正常获取安装包列表或下载安装包,可能需要FQ,大家也可以去Flutter github项目下去下载安装包, 懒癌患者可以直接点击本链接下载,随着版本升级此链接可能会失效...运行 echo $PATH验证目录是否在已经在PATH中,正确输出如下,每个电脑输出可能不一样,但当你看到flutter路径出现即说明配置成功。...平台设置 macOS支持为iOSAndroid开发Flutter应用程序。...现在完成两个平台设置步骤中至少一个,以便能够构建并运行第一个Flutter应用程序 至此,全部环境搭建步骤结束,不敢保证全部正确,但我尽可能把我安装过程问题都列了出来,希望可以帮到各位同学,

4.1K10

搭建Hadoop3集群

ResourceManager:管理YARN作业,监管节点上调度进程执行进程。 节点存储实际数据并提供处理能力来运行作业。...Executors:一些由AM创建Executors,用于真正运行该作业。 对于MapReduce作业,executors会并行执行mapreduce操作。 两者都在从节点容器中运行。...每个节点都运行一个NodeManager守护进程,负责在节点上创建容器。 整个集群由一个ResourceManager管理,它根据容量要求和当前使用情况调度所有所有节点上容器分配。...还可以使用以下命令打印正在运行节点报告: yarn node -list 如果运行错误,需要检查YARN配置文件hadoop/yarn-site.xml是否配置错误。...可以使用以下命令获取正在运行应用程序列表: yarn application -list 要获得yarn命令所有可用参数,请参阅Apache YARN文档 与HDFS一样,YARN提供了一个友好

1.1K21

开发一款简易APP

希望打开APP后,显示当前时间..可能不实用,重在体验 安装Flutter 如果在arm架构 Mac 电脑上进行开发,需要安装 Rosetta 2, 因为一些辅助工具需要,可通过手动运行下面的命令来安装...要在 Android iOS 设备上安装 Flutter 应用程序,需要先将应用程序打包为相应安装包格式,即 APK(Android) IPA(iOS)。...以下是针对每个平台步骤: 在 Android 上安装应用程序: 生成 APK 文件: 打开终端或命令提示符,并导航到 Flutter 项目目录。...我用是传到天翼云盘上面 在 iOS 上安装应用程序: 在 iOS 上安装应用程序比较复杂,因为苹果设备上应用程序必须经过苹果审核签名过程才能安装。...在 Xcode 中运行应用程序,它将自动在设备上安装。 这种方法只适用于开发者,并且需要使用 Xcode。

7310

客户端软件GUI开发技术漫谈:原生与跨平台解决方案分析

WPF不能运行在其他操作系统,并且在XAML中编写样式表,通用性还是不如HTML强,学习应用范围来讲,还是HTML更好一些。...对于企业而言,一套业务逻辑可以在多处使用是最理想也是最保险。 Electron Electron是由Github开发,用HTML,CSSJavaScript来构建跨平台桌面应用程序一个开源库。...应用程序配置保存在config.xml文件中。...使用 Visual Studio 在 C# 中编写跨平台应用程序。  Xamarin 允许在每个平台上创建本机 UI,并在 C# 中编写跨平台共享业务逻辑。...因为Android自带了 Skia,所以 Flutter Android SDK要比 iOS SDK小很多。 QT C++ QT最大优势就是跨平台!高效率!

14.4K30

Flutter为什么使用Dart?

借助Flutter,我们希望使开发人员能够创建快速,流畅用户体验。为了实现这一点,我们需要能够在每个动画帧中运行大量最终开发人员代码。...Dart允许Flutter避免使用像JSX或XML这样声明式布局语言,也不需要单独可视化界面构建器,因为Dart声明式程序化布局易于阅读可视化。...特别是,JIT编译器启动时间较慢,因为在程序开始运行时,JIT编译器必须在执行代码之前进行分析编译。研究表明,如果开始执行需要花费几秒钟时间,那么很多人就会放弃该应用程序。...竞争状况是双重打击,因为它们可能导致严重错误,包括使应用程序崩溃并导致数据丢失,而且由于依赖于独立线程相对时间,因此特别难以查找修复它们。...在调试器中运行应用程序时,竞争条件会停止表现出来,这很常见。 解决争用条件典型方法是使用防止其他线程执行锁来保护共享资源,但是锁本身可能会导致棘手甚至更严重问题(包括死锁饥饿)。

1.4K20

腾讯位置服务Flutter业务实践——地图SDK Flutter插件实现(一)

Flutter项目开发过程中,对插件开发复用能够提高开发效率,降低工程耦合度。Flutter开发者可以引入对应插件就可以为项目快速集成相关能力,从而专注于具体业务功能实现。...现如今,地图SDK已经迭代到了4.4.0版本,笔者也将地图Flutter插件进行了一次相关版本升级。本篇文章将介绍地图Flutter插件项目的构建、地图实例加载以及demo示例呈现。...地图Flutter插件依赖配置项 Android端Flutter插件配置项与官网关于Android地图SDK配置说明类似,需要配置android目录下两个文件:build.gradle、AndroidManifest.xml...,在Android端Flutter端注册viewType中字符串值必须保持一致,用于唯一标识。.../services/platfo 根据控制台输出信息,经过查阅相关资料后找到了原因:该问题Flutter版本升级导致重大更改引起:https://groups.google.com/g/flutter-announce

4K61

已有iOS工程中加入Flutter之Cocoapods+Flutter环境方式集成

错误 Note:应用程序将无法在Release模式下运行到模拟器上,因为Flutter尚不支持Dart代码输出x86预编译(AOT)二进制文件。...为Flutter引擎,已编译Dart代码所有Flutter插件创建Framework。手动嵌入Framework,并在Xcode中更新现有应用程序构建设置。...4.2 podfile导入 首先,此方法要求在您项目上工作每个开发人员都必须具有本地安装Flutter SDK版本。 只需在Xcode中构建应用程序即可自动运行脚本以嵌入Dart插件代码。...然后,应用程序目录下需要再次运行pod install。 podhelper.rb脚本将您插件Flutter.frameworkApp.framework嵌入到您项目中。...您FlutterDart状态将超过一个FlutterViewController生存时间。 在显示UI之前,您应用程序插件可以与FlutterDart逻辑进行交互。

2.1K30

为什么说Flutter让移动开发变得更好?

这似乎是一个合适选择,因为它可以让我以入门姿态比较两种框架优劣,同时不会过分关注应用程序架构。...该应用程序包含了电影电视节目,并且开发过程中没有遇到任何困难。我通过构建用于加载显示数据泛型类来实现,这使得我可以重复使用电影演出每个布局。...但仔细想想又在意料之中:因为所有的布局,背景,图标等都需要用XML来指定,并且仍然需要使用Java / Kotlin代码连接到应用程序, 这里产生了大量代码。...当然,这仅仅是Flutter开始,因为它仍处于测试阶段,远没有Android成熟。 不过,相比之下,Android似乎已经达到了极限,很快就可以使用Flutter中编写Android应用程序了。...但让我告诉你一点:在使用Flutter之后,你将开始理解目前Android开发存在问题,并且很明显Flutter设计更适合现代,响应式应用程序

2K10

Apache Solr介绍及安装

SolrLucene本质区别有以下三点:搜索服务器、企业级管理。Lucene本质上是搜索库,不是独立应用程序,而Solr是。Lucene专注于搜索底层建设,而Solr专注于企业应用。...安装与配置 以solr-4.4.0为例,解压之后目录如下: ➜ solr-4.4.0 tree -L 1 . ├── CHANGES.txt ├── contrib ├── dist ├── docs...在Jetty上运行Solr 在example目录下,运行下面命令即可启动一个内置jetty容器: $ java -Dsolr.solr.home=/tmp/solrhome -jar start.jar...这时候启动tomcat后访问http://localhost:8080/solr会提示错误,这是因为solr home目录下没有solr配置文件一些目录。...请将solr-4.4.0/example/solr/目录下文件拷贝到solr home目录下,例如: $ cp -r solr-4.4.0/example/solr/ /tmp/solrhome/ 最后

1.1K40

Flutter常见开发问题

/ 它与基于 WebView 应用程序有何不同? 简单地回答这个问题:您为 WebView 或类似运行应用程序编写代码必须经过多个层才能最终执行。...本质上讲,Flutter 通过编译为原生 ARM代码以在两个平台上执行,从而实现了跨越。“混合”应用程序缓慢、缓慢,并且看起来与它们运行平台不同。...Flutter 应用程序运行速度比它们混合应用程序快得多。此外,使用插件访问原生组件传感器比使用无法充分利用其平台 WebView 更容易。...简而言之,这些文件夹是整个应用程序,它们为 Flutter 代码运行奠定了基础。 为什么我 Flutter 应用这么大? 如果您运行Flutter 应用程序,您就会知道它速度很快。速度极快。...所以对于大多数应用,我认为不会有大问题。 您需要记住一件事是 Flutter依赖于 Android iOS 项目,您至少需要熟悉其中项目结构。

6.7K20

Flutter常见开发问题

/ 它与基于 WebView 应用程序有何不同? 简单地回答这个问题:您为 WebView 或类似运行应用程序编写代码必须经过多个层才能最终执行。...本质上讲,Flutter 通过编译为原生 ARM代码以在两个平台上执行,从而实现了跨越。“混合”应用程序缓慢、缓慢,并且看起来与它们运行平台不同。...Flutter 应用程序运行速度比它们混合应用程序快得多。此外,使用插件访问原生组件传感器比使用无法充分利用其平台 WebView 更容易。...简而言之,这些文件夹是整个应用程序,它们为 Flutter 代码运行奠定了基础。 为什么我 Flutter 应用这么大? 如果您运行Flutter 应用程序,您就会知道它速度很快。速度极快。...所以对于大多数应用,我认为不会有大问题。 您需要记住一件事是 Flutter依赖于 Android iOS 项目,您至少需要熟悉其中项目结构。

6.8K30

Flutter技术与实战(1)

课前必读 为什么每一位大前端从业者都应该学习Flutter Flutter开辟了全新思路,提供了一整套底层渲染逻辑到上层开发语言完整解决方案:视图渲染完全闭环在其框架内部,不依赖于底层操作系统提供任何组件...如同 Kotlin Swift 出现,分别是为了解决 Java Objective-C 在编写应用程序一些实际问题一样,Dart 诞生正是要解决 JavaScript 存在、在语言本质上无法改进缺陷...JIT 在运行时即时编译,在开发周期中使用,可以动态下发执行代码,开发测试效率高,但运行速度执行性能则会因为运行时即时编译受到影响。...Dart 声明式编程布局易于阅读可视化,使得 Flutter 并不需要类似 JSX 或 XML 声明式布局语言。...所有的布局都使用同一种格式,也使得 Flutter 很容易提供高级工具使布局更简单。 开发过程也不需要可视化界面构建器,因为热重载可以让我们立即在手机上看到运行效果。

44720

记住,永远都不要在 Flutter 中使用全局变量

全局变量似乎是很棒 Flutter 程序组件,因为它们被声明一次并且可以被程序中每个函数访问。...如何以更好方式管理状态 Flutter 是一个跨平台动态框架,用于收集处理来自用户数据。 开关到单选按钮,必须有效地管理数据状态。但是,全局变量会增加应用程序数据流复杂性。...全局变量使数据很容易发生变异,这可能会导致处理用户那里收集数据时出现混乱。 provider 等状态管理包可用于缓解全局变量带来问题。以下是可用于管理状态状态包管理器列表: 1....使用以下代码片段添加使用 Provider 包插件: dependencies: flutter: sdk: flutter provider: ^3.1.0 Provider 程序包还允许你与多个类共享小部件状态...这将节省你时间,因为你将在运行时将缺陷添加到你应用程序之前修复错误。 4. Redux Redux 是一个库,可帮助你有效地管理小部件数据状态。

3.4K30

为什么Flutter会选择 Dart ?

Dart使Flutter不需要单独声明式布局语言,如JSX或XML,或单独可视化界面构建器,因为Dart声明式编程布局易于阅读可视化。...在开发过程中AOT编译,开发周期(更改程序到能够执行程序以查看更改结果时间)总是很慢。但是AOT编译产生程序可以更可预测地执行,并且运行时不需要停下来分析编译。...在开发过程中,Flutter使用JIT编译器,通常可以在一秒之内重新加载并继续执行代码。只要有可能,应用程序状态在重新加载时保留下来,以便应用程序可以停止地方继续。...这也会带来流畅滚动动画效果,而不会出现卡顿。 统一布局 Dart另一个好处是,Flutter不会程序中拆分出额外模板或布局语言,如JSX或XML,也不需要单独可视布局工具。...与许多公司一样,它们利用不同语言、工具程序员为每个平台(Web、iOSAndroid)构建独立应用程序。切换到Dart意味着他们不再需要雇佣三种不同程序员。

2K30

博客wordpress迁移到hexo

INFO Post found: 人生之癌 INFO Post found: 一次被***删除***程序经历 INFO Post found: HTTP请求11个处理阶段 INFO Post...Post found: Python通过ItChat获取朋友图像生成拼接图 INFO Post found: 论易经三教关系 INFO Post found: Mysql Redis PostgreSQL...数据库查看客户端连接 INFO Post found: 第十名现象说起 INFO Post found: 高效工作五种策略 INFO Post found: 全链路监控工具Pinpoint1.8.2...部署 INFO Post found: 一个人清欢 INFO Post found: 围炉夜话精选 INFO Post found: Java线程泄露问题分析 INFO Post found:...found: 制作java基础docker镜像 INFO Post found: Java应用程序镜像制作及在kubernetes上发布 INFO Post found: 麦肯锡教我思考武器:逻辑思考到真正解决问题

94630

开始使用-编写你第一个Flutter应用程序

这是因为配对这个词是在构建方法内部生成,每次MaterialApp需要渲染时或者在Flutter Inspector中切换平台时都会运行。 ? 问题? 如果您应用程序运行不正常,请查找错别字。...尽可能向下滚动,您将继续看到新单词配对。 ? 问题? 如果您应用程序运行不正常,则可以使用以下链接中代码重新进入正轨。...热重新加载应用程序。 你应该能够点击任何一行以获得最喜欢,或不适合入口。 请注意,点击一行会生成心脏图标发出隐式墨迹飞溅动画。 ? 问题?...您将学习如何在主路由新路由之间导航。 在Flutter中,导航器管理包含应用程序路由堆栈。 将路由推入导航器堆栈,将显示更新为该路由。 导航器堆栈中弹出路由,将显示返回到前一个路由。...您已经编写了一个在iOSAndroid上运行交互式Flutter应用程序。 在这个codelab中,你有: 从头开始创建一个Flutter应用程序。 书写Dart代码。 利用外部第三方库。

9.5K20

Jira服务工作台路径遍历导致敏感信息泄露漏洞分析

以下是作者对该漏洞简单复现分享。...JIRA Servcie Desk介绍 JIRA Servcie Desk是Atlassian旗下JIRA类应用核心产品,它是一款服务台管理软件,专门用于接受处理来自于团队或用户问题或请求它还有其他类似于服务中心附属功能包括处理服务协议...before 4.4.1 (the fixed version for 4.4.x) 漏洞复现 首先,我们要检查是目标JIRA项目实例是否运行有JIRA Servcie Desk服务,可以通过以下链接来核实...然而,因为管理员门户中大多功能都是通过APIs来实现,但是其APIs对URL字符处理比较奇怪,存在问题,使得正常浏览存在貌似坏页问题。.../sr/jira.issueviews:searchrequest-xml/temp/SearchRequest.xml?

2.3K30
领券